I had my speedo/tripmeter calibrated this past winter by Foreign Speedo. Their ad is on pg. 5 of 2023 Sept. "Airmail". I gave them a call first to give a heads up and the turnaround was very reasonable. If i remember correctly less than 2 weeks.
After reinstalling back on the bike (81 R100RT) i checked the speedo against a GPS unit and it was spot on up to 55 mph. After 55 it was off on the high side 2-3 mph the faster you go, stopped at mach 1. Anyway worth a try.
